Alright, let's get down to the nitty-gritty of making payments over $1000 with iOSKO in Australia. Generally, iOSKO allows for substantial transactions, but there might be some specific considerations depending on your account type and the policies of iOSKO. Most platforms have limits to comply with financial regulations and to manage risk. For payments over a certain amount, like $1000, you might need to go through additional verification steps. This is a standard procedure to ensure the security of the transaction and to comply with anti-money laundering (AML) regulations. This could involve providing more detailed information about the transaction, such as the purpose of the payment and the identity of the recipient. It's always a good idea to check iOSKO's terms and conditions or contact their customer support for the most up-to-date information regarding payment limits. They'll be able to provide precise details tailored to your account and location.

Security Measures for Large Transactions
Alright, let's talk about security. When you're making large payments, you want to be extra cautious. iOSKO takes security seriously, but it's also important to take your own precautions. First off, make sure your account is secure. Enable two-factor authentication (2FA) for an extra layer of protection. This will require you to enter a code from your phone or another device in addition to your password when logging in. Always use a strong, unique password for your iOSKO account. Avoid using easily guessable passwords or reusing passwords from other accounts. Keep your contact information up-to-date. This ensures that you receive important security notifications and can recover your account if needed. Verify the recipient's details. Double-check the recipient's email address or bank details before sending a large payment to ensure that the money goes to the right person. Be wary of phishing scams. Never click on suspicious links or provide your account details in response to unsolicited emails or messages. If something seems off, it probably is. Regularly review your transaction history to spot any unauthorized activity. If you see anything unusual, report it to iOSKO immediately.

iOSKO vs. Alternatives: Comparing Your Options
It's always a good idea to consider your options, guys. While iOSKO is a solid choice, let's compare it with some alternatives to see if they might be a better fit for your needs. PayPal is one of the most well-known payment platforms, widely used for both personal and business transactions. PayPal offers strong buyer and seller protection, making it a good choice for online purchases and sales. However, PayPal's fees can sometimes be higher, especially for international transactions. Wise (formerly TransferWise) is a popular option for international money transfers. Wise offers competitive exchange rates and low fees, making it a great choice for sending money across borders. Payoneer is another platform, particularly favored by freelancers and businesses that receive international payments. Payoneer provides multiple ways to receive payments and offers various financial services, but its fees and features may be more complex. Before deciding, consider the transaction type, fees, security features, and overall user experience to choose the right platform. Assess your specific needs, such as the volume of transactions, currencies, and features required. Compare the fees, including transaction fees, currency conversion fees, and any hidden charges. Evaluate the security features. Check for encryption, two-factor authentication, and fraud protection measures. Check the user interface and ease of use. A user-friendly platform can save you time and reduce potential errors.
